Amethi, April 18

Advertisement

Six people returning from a wedding ceremony died while four others got seriously injured after their jeep collided head-on with a truck in Gauriganj area of the district, police said on Monday.

Superintendent of Police Dinesh Singh said the accident took place near Babuganj Sagra Ashram on Sunday night.

He said the Bolero jeep was returning from Nasirabad area of Rae Bareli with people from different villages in Amethi.

The deceased have been identified as Kallu (40), his 8-year-old son Saurabh, Krishna Kumar Singh (30), Shiv Milan, Ravi Tiwari and Triveni Prasad, the SP said.

He said four others were seriously injured, and were admitted to the district hospital, from where they were referred to Lucknow.

Witnesses said the jeep was shattered under the impact of the crash.

The bodies had been sent for post-mortem, the SP said.
